Job Description:

This is an exciting opportunity for an experienced and motivated clinician to lead the Sedgemoor MSK community Physiotherapy Hub as a Band 7 MSK Hub Lead. This pivotal role combines clinical expertise with strong, demonstrable leadership, providing day‑to‑day operational management of the service while supporting the delivery of high‑quality patient care.

You will lead, inspire and develop the physiotherapy team, fostering a positive, open and learning culture while ensuring effective service delivery within a busy and evolving environment. You will work closely with the wider cMSK leadership team and other Hub Leads across the Trust to ensure consistency, innovation and continuous improvement across the service.

Alongside leadership responsibilities, you will maintain a clinical caseload and provide advanced specialist advice, supporting clinical decision‑making and workforce development. You will play a key role in service development, pathway improvement and ensuring the team meets national standards and local priorities.

This role requires a confident, visible leader with excellent communication, decision‑making and people management skills, who can drive change, support colleagues and deliver high‑quality outcomes for patients across the Hub.

Main duties of the job

You will take responsibility for the operational delivery of MSK Physiotherapy services within the Sedgemoor Hub, ensuring effective coordination of staffing, clinic capacity and day‑to‑day service performance. This will include oversight of workload allocation, supporting department leads to manage demand and addressing any issues impacting access, flow or quality of care.

A key part of the role will be working with the wider cMSK leadership team to implement service priorities, standardise ways of working and ensure alignment with Trust objectives. You will contribute to workforce planning, support recruitment and retention, and ensure colleagues have clear objectives and development plans in place.

You will be accountable for maintaining high clinical standards across the Hub, providing specialist input into complex cases and supporting consistent decision‑making across the team. You will also lead on aspects of clinical governance, including monitoring performance, responding to incidents and complaints, and contributing to audit, quality improvement and service evaluation activity.

You will actively support the implementation of change initiatives, embedding new pathways and ensuring staff are engaged and supported through service developments.
